Maximizing Your Time for Greater Success

Time is one of life's most valuable resources, and making the most of it is critical to achieving greater success. To make the best use of your time, prioritize tasks based on their importance and urgency. It's also critical to eliminate distractions like social media notifications and unnecessary meetings that sap your productivity.

A routine, in addition to prioritizing and eliminating distractions, can help you maximize your time. A morning routine, in particular, sets the tone for the rest of the day and allows you to focus on the most important tasks. This routine may include activities such as exercise, meditation, and day planning. By sticking to a routine, you eliminate decision fatigue and free up mental energy to focus on your objectives.

Delegating tasks to others is another way to maximize your time. This allows you to concentrate on your strengths and the areas where you can make the most impact in your organization. It also provides opportunities for others within the company to learn and grow.

Making the most of your time is critical to achieving greater success. You can maximize your time and achieve your goals by prioritizing tasks, eliminating distractions, developing routines, and delegating tasks.

Mindfulness and Meditation Techniques to Improve Concentration

Mindfulness and meditation have been shown to improve focus and concentration, resulting in increased productivity. You can improve your ability to focus on tasks and avoid distractions by training your mind to stay present and aware of the moment. Here are a few mindfulness and meditation techniques to add to your morning routine to increase productivity:

Breathing Exercises:

Spend a few minutes every morning practicing deep breathing. Close your eyes and take slow, deep breaths while sitting in a comfortable position. Concentrate on each inhale and exhale while clearing your mind of any distracting thoughts. This practice can help you relax, reduce stress and anxiety, and improve your ability to concentrate.

Mindful Walking:

Take a walk outside and observe your surroundings. Take in the sights, sounds, and smells that surround you. As you walk, pay attention to each step and the sensations in your body. This practice can help you clear your mind, raise your awareness, and sharpen your focus.

Body Scan Meditation:

Lie down in a comfortable position and scan your entire body from head to toe. Pay attention to each part of your body, noting any sensations or tension. Allow yourself to unwind and let go of any tension or tightness. This practice can help you control your emotions and improve your concentration.

You can improve your ability to focus, reduce stress and anxiety, and increase your productivity levels throughout the day by incorporating these mindfulness and meditation techniques into your morning routine.
